Tuesday, August 23, 2011 Earthquake

The earthquake hit United States on Tuesday, August 23, 2011 at 17:51 UTC with a magnitude of 5.8. The closest known location in the current dataset is Tuckahoe (United States - US), about 48.8 km away. The epicenter is located at longitude -77.936 and latitude 37.910.
